Kyrylo Maslakhov

By profession, I am a builder. I was involved in constructing solar power plants, coordinating the supply of special metal structures for them, and managing the setup process. At one point, we contributed to the development of "green" technologies in our country. I also worked on building residential homes, and I loved seeing the results of my work, especially when people entered their new homes for the first time. That chapter of my life ended after 2022.

I decided to transition into the humanitarian field when I realized I couldn't stay on the sidelines of the crisis caused by the war. I wanted to personally help people endure and adapt to the new realities.

There was instant chemistry between me and the "Responsible Citizens" team when we first met. In such a team, you understand that these are people of action. I immediately joined the team’s large-scale project in collaboration with Mercy Corps, where I worked as a registrar and trainer for local teams, registering people for cash assistance.

The values I rely on in my work are responsibility for decisions and actions. I consider this to be my foundation, stemming from my construction background.
